2025 Distinguished Alumni Award
The Distinguished Alumni Award honors an Equal Justice Works Alum who demonstrates an outstanding commitment to public interest, service, and community throughout their career.

Taylor Sartor
Senior Staff Attorney at the L. David Shear Children’s Law Center of Bay Area Legal Services, Inc.
Taylor Sartor is a Senior Staff Attorney at the L. David Shear Children’s Law Center of Bay Area Legal Services where she represents youth and young adults in the foster care system in dependency proceedings, administrative hearings, and in the education setting.
Taylor focuses on issues related to human trafficking, disabilities, commitment in psychiatric facilities, aging out of foster care, school to prison pipeline prevention, systemic impact advocacy and litigation, and more. Taylor is also the Creator and Legal Director of FosterPower, the first mobile app in the country to provide comprehensive information on benefits, protections, and legal rights for youth in foster care.
Taylor served as an Equal Justice Works Fellow at the Children’s Law Center from 2018-2020 where she specialized in representing youth in group home care and successfully advocated for over 85 percent of her clients to transition into family-like settings. Taylor received a bachelor’s degree in English literature, magna cum laude, from Florida State University in 2014. She earned her Juris Doctor with a Certificate of Concentration in Social Justice Advocacy from Stetson University College of Law in 2018.
Taylor is the founder of the organization Child Advocates of Stetson Law.
